"Sanitary regulations" includes all laws and ordinances
relating to the production, handling, transportation, distri-
bution and sale of milk, and, so far as applicable thereto,
the regulations of the several departments and boards re-
ferred to under "health authorities. "'
"Milk dealer" includes all persons hereinafter defined as
distributor, producer-distributor, distributing broker, and
all persons conducting a retail store as herein defined.
"Distributor" includes all persons who purchase, or han-
dle milk within this State for sale, shipment, storage, proc-
essing, or manufacture into dairy products within or with-
out the State other than solely for manufacture into but-
ter or cheese. Said term, however, excludes all persons so
purchasing, or handling milk for the purpose only of sale by
such persons, in one or more retail stores, or in one or more
places where such milk is sold to customers for consump-
tion on the premises if such persons do not pasteurize,
standardize, or otherwise process such milk, and excludes
all persons hereinafter included under the term "distrib-
uting broker".
"Producer-distributor" includes all persons owning,
managing or controlling a dairy herd or herds who put the
milk produced therefrom in bottles or other containers in
which the same is designed to be sold, or cool, pasteurize,
standardize, or otherwise process such milk or manufac-
ture it into any dairy product other than solely for manu-
facture into butter and cheese for the purpose of distribut-
ing the same at wholesale or retail, or who distribute such
milk at wholesale or retail.
"Producer" includes all persons owning, managing, or
controlling a dairy herd or herds, excepting those herein-
before defined as "producer-distributors. "
"Distributing broker" includes all persons who on their
own account accept or receive milk from a distributor or
producer-distributor for sale or distribution at wholesale or
retail.
"Delivery vehicle" includes all vehicles used for making
delivery of milk either at wholesale or retail.
"Retail store" includes all places where milk is sold for
consumption off the premises.
